The Mexico crude oil desalter market is witnessing steady growth driven by the country`s significant oil production capacity. Desalters are essential in the oil refining process to remove salt and other impurities from crude oil, ensuring efficient refining operations and high-quality end products. In the Mexico crude oil desalter market, some challenges include technological limitations in efficiently removing salts and impurities from the crude oil, leading to decreased efficiency and quality of the final product. Additionally, the high energy consumption and operational costs associated with desalting processes can pose financial challenges for companies operating in the market. Furthermore, environmental concerns regarding the disposal of salty wastewater generated during the desalting process can also be a significant challenge, especially considering the strict regulations in place for environmental protection. Overall, addressing these challenges will require continuous innovation in desalting technologies, cost-effective solutions to reduce operational expenses, and sustainable practices for managing wastewater to ensure the long-term viability of the Mexico crude oil desalter market.

Government policies related to the Mexico crude oil desalter market focus on promoting the development of the oil industry while also emphasizing environmental sustainability. The Mexican government has implemented regulations requiring oil companies to invest in desalting technology to reduce the salt content in crude oil, which helps enhance the quality of refined products and reduces corrosion in pipelines and refineries. Additionally, there are incentives for companies that adopt efficient desalting processes to improve overall operational efficiency and minimize environmental impact. These policies aim to ensure the competitiveness of Mexico`s oil industry on a global scale while prioritizing sustainable practices for long-term growth.
